Transaction 353507383884ce521effdd21337a0943828a1041e0753cc4e541128f9aa32815
1 Input
1 Output
-
353507383884ce521effdd21337a0943828a1041e0753cc4e541128f9aa32815:0
- value
- 4923217
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 454b8ad5bb9ef6d4ca8ecc98028fcfc69e520086 OP_EQUALVERIFY OP_CHECKSIG
- address
- 17KQ81XBxQA6FtmwuPpfLNgXhsFi3MXT4F